He’s not a full Brazil international in a particularly strong era for them. They don’t possess a wealth of attacking talent right now. From Ronaldo as their starting number 9, to Jesus, it’s quite a drop. It’s a bleedin enormous drop. Elber, Jardel (at Porto), Edmundo, these fellas couldn’t get a look in for Brazil in the era of Ronaldo and Romario. Now they’d walk into the team.

Starting for Brazil when they had great talent is akin to being heavyweight champion in an era of Tyson, Holyfield, Lewis and Bowe. It was a statement of your credentials. Starting for Brazil when Jesus is you main striker is akin to Anthony Joshua holding all the heavyweight belts, a man whom Ray Mercer (never got to hold a belt in that quality era) would clobber.
